The Special Adviser to the Governor of Taraba State on Transportation, Hon Jerry Tyolanga has condemned in strong terms the militia attack on a commuter bus in Taraba State along Wukari – Jootar road who were traveling to Abinsi in Benue State for a Conference.

Hon. Tyolanga noted that the attack which claimed the driver’s life, leaving several others with severe injuries, was unfortunate, regrettable and condemnable adding that, it was an attempt to disrupt the peace efforts of His Excellency, Dr. Agbu Kefas and his Benue counterpart, Rev. Fr. Dr. Hyacinth Alia.
He however, extended his condolence to the family of the driver who lost his life during the incident and further prayed for quick recovery for those who sustained injuries.
“It is unfortunate that travelers are constantly attacked on the high-ways thus, rendering our roads unsafe.
“This criminal act calls for serious security concern and check because, we cannot afford to watch our transporters fall victim to criminal activities of such magnitude,” he said.
He further called on Security Agencies/Operatives in Taraba and Benue States to thoroughly investigate the matter and bring the perpetrators to book to prevent further attacks on high – ways.
